Nigeria vs South Africa Passport Comparison Overview (2026)

This comparison analyzes visa-free access, ranking trends, and mobility metrics for Nigeria vs South Africa. South Africa currently leads this comparison with 100 visa-free destinations, while Nigeria has 44. Use the detailed sections below to compare practical travel access and historical changes.

  • 15 visa-free destinations are shared by all compared passports.
  • The largest exclusive advantage is 53 destination(s) unique to one passport in this comparison.
